Physical Therapist

Trellis Health: Brunswick and/or Portland, Maine

Trellis Health is seeking a Physical Therapist for their practice in Brunswick and/or Portland, Maine to bring musculoskeletal (MSK) expertise to enhance Member function, reduce pain, and improve overall health outcomes while ensuring clear communication, shared decision-making, and a coordinated, evidence-based approach within Trellis Health’s relationship-centered model of care.

\n

Requirements

  • Doctor of Physical Therapy (DPT) degree from a program accredited by the American Physical Therapy Association (APTA).
  • Current applicable state temporary/permanent license as a Physical Therapist required or in compliance with the state practice act.
  • BLS certification (current or obtained within 30 days of hire).
  • 3+ years of experience working in a hospital, long-term care, or outpatient Physical Therapy department preferred.
  • Advanced skills used in operating equipment and materials used in conducting physical therapy treatments; proficiency in performing such treatments.
  • Analytical ability necessary to conduct a thorough evaluation of patient abilities and disabilities, physical strength and limitations, develop sound treatment plans, and assess patient’s progress

Benefits

  • Rewarding opportunity with an employer who is building a new model of primary care while delivering it in real time, grounded in relationships, access, and collaboration
  • Competitive salary with bonus structure and sign on bonus
  • Medical, Dental and Vision options
  • HSA
  • Retirement plan options
  • Generous PTO and paid holidays

Responsibilities

  • Evaluate Members, establish current physical status, and develop an individualized physical therapy program.
  • Collaborate with provider team, including primary care and specialty providers, to optimize care plan and Member experience.
  • Incorporate physical therapy treatment programs in support of and according to provider’s referral and/or individualized plan.
  • Conduct telehealth visits to support and promote access to care.
  • Document all therapeutic treatments, communicate treatment, and evaluate problems.
  • Coordinate and communicate with other disciplines as required by individual Member needs.
  • Proactively identify, report, and participate in the resolution of any potential or actual Member safety issues.
  • Work collaboratively and cooperatively with care team members; interact positively and effectively with others to promote a team environment.
